    Get the Led Out.. Today is the birthday of Jimmy Page..

    James Patrick Page (born 9 January 1944) guitarist, composer and record producer.
    He began his career as a studio sessio guitarist in London and was subsequently a member of The Yardbirds from 1966 to 1968, after which he co-founded the English rock band Led Zeppelin...

    Early Zep was the best-- from '68 through '72. There certainly was some damned good music performed afterward but the quality of the performances dropped off pretty dramatically in the later years.

    The Yardbirds pretty much disintegrated in '68 leaving Jimmy Page with some tour date commitments to fulfill and for the sake of his musical career he needed to make good on them so he threw together what was originally to be the New Yardbirds until Keith Moon famously coined the name that stuck- Led Zeppelin.
